Content DescriptionReturn to Top
Family photographs of Adolph "Duffie" and Effie Miller, of Dixie, Idaho, featuring family members, friends and relatives, vacations, hunting and fishing trips, mining, railroad construction, and rodeos; accompanied by birth and graduation announcements, poems, songs, and other items. The first folder contains photos affixed to a scrapbook type album. The majority of the rest of the items are loose but have been removed from a similar album. Additional materials include a steroscope and books from Miller family.
Historical NoteReturn to Top
Adolph "Duffie" Miller was born in 27 January 1897 in Nykoring Mors, Denmark. He arrived in the United States via New York City on the vessel Norge in approximately 1898. He married Effie L. Powelson. He worked in various mines around Dixie and Elk City, Idaho, often employed as a furnaceman. Miller died in 1988 and was buried in Grangeville, Idaho.
Effie L. Powelson Miller was born in 1890 in Castle Rock, Washington to Howard Powelson and Emma May Boultinghouse. She married Duffie Miller. Effie Miller died in 1975 and is buried in Grangeville, Idaho.
